BiographyHistory

Cecilia Mary Caddell was an Irish novelist some of whose work was published in Australian colonial newspapers and magazines in the nineteenth century.

According to Stephen J. Brown, in Ireland in Fiction, Caddell was a member of 'an old Catholic family that through times of persecution clung to the faith and at the same time retained the family estates ... Though Miss Caddell suffered much from bad health she contributed to many Catholic periodicals. As a rule her writings were devoted to the illustration of Irish history and the Catholic faith.'

Source: Brown, Stephen J. Ireland in Fiction: A Guide to Irish Novels, Tales, Romances, and Folk-Lore (1919): 50, https://openlibrary.org/books/OL7232874M/Ireland_in_fiction
